Output 24831baf935077ce0dc8f72385eabe15d40d464cdebd69fbf539085697fcf527:3

value
39371596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a12858b3fed0033ea1a9dba5c4a085f36a2ed1b OP_EQUAL
address
MMwpUsxCcTTBerZ1Wt91pjYbyNhtfJqpds
transaction
24831baf935077ce0dc8f72385eabe15d40d464cdebd69fbf539085697fcf527
spent
true